Ergonomics and Hardware Feel

The Genki Manta looks relatively bulky in product photos, projecting an image of a heavy, unwieldy brick. Reality paints a different picture. Despite its substantial look, it fits comfortably in the hands and offers good overall ergonomics. The weight distribution feels balanced, ensuring that long gaming sessions don't lead to immediate fatigue.

It is under the hood—and around the edges—where the Manta truly separates itself from the competition. It uses modern technology, specifically TMR (Tunnel Magnetoresistance) joysticks. Unlike traditional Hall Effect sticks, these TMR sticks offer lower power consumption and higher precision, but the real party trick here is adjustability. The resistance of the sticks can be easily adjusted by turning them, allowing users to dial in the exact tension they prefer for shooters versus racing sims. Additionally, the triggers feature adjustable travel, and the action buttons are not limited to simple "on/off" states; they register analog input. This at least makes precise throttle and brake control in racing games conceivable, blurring the line between a standard gamepad and a racing wheel setup.

Next-Gen Feedback and Repairability

Where the Manta truly shines is its feedback system. It is advertised as providing particularly precise and configurable feedback through Maglev linear motors. While "HD Rumble" has become a buzzword in the industry, the Genki Manta’s implementation felt genuinely convincing during testing. The vibrations are tight, localized, and capable of producing distinct textures rather than a generic buzz.

You can even adjust the frequency of the Rumble feature
While the controller itself is not fully modular in the way something like the Victrix Pro BFG is (you can’t swap the stick layout), the internal design suggests a focus on longevity. The battery should be replaceable, which is a rarity in modern controllers. Because the front and back are connected by plugs rather than cables, the internal layout is clean. According to the manufacturer, the controller is easy to open by removing the screws, making user maintenance a viable possibility rather than a warranty-voiding nightmare.

MantaOS: A Screen That Actually Matters

We were unable to test the controller across different game genres at the trade show due to the controlled environment, but we did manage to take a very detailed look at the integrated display and the MantaOS operating system. Whereas most controller screens are gimmicks, MantaOS feels like a legitimate piece of software.

The display allows for extensive configuration options
Powered by a Raspberry Pi RP2350, the operating system offers a surprisingly wide range of possibilities. The controller can be configured entirely via the display, for example, eliminating the need to install additional software on a PC. This is a massive quality-of-life win for users who hate managing peripheral apps. Macro programming is supported natively, including a "prerecording" feature: much like a dashcam, it allows recently executed button combinations to be captured retroactively. If you just pulled off a complex combo but forgot to hit record, you can still save it.

Settings can be saved in eight distinct profiles, and the UI is snappy and intuitive. The team has even managed to get small games running directly on the controller, turning the device into a mini handheld console when you are away from your desk. If an ecosystem develops around MantaOS, this could potentially provide significant added value. According to Human Things, conceivable and not entirely unrealistic possibilities include controlling streaming software and OBS Studio, as well as integrating an IR transmitter for controlling TVs.

Compatibility and Final Impressions

The Genki Manta is aiming for universal compatibility. It is compatible not only with PCs but also with the Nintendo Switch and the upcoming Switch 2, making it a potential single-controller solution for multi-platform households.

In a world where gamers are often asked to pay $180 for a controller with stick drift, the Genki Manta stands out as a bold, engineering-forward alternative. The hardware feels premium, the software is surprisingly mature, and the analog face buttons offer a level of control we rarely see outside of specialized fight pads. If Human Things can deliver on the February timeline and maintain this level of polish, the Manta might just be the sleeper hit of 2026.
